Red Bean Milk Buns Recipe
Introduction
Red Bean Milk Buns are soft, fluffy, and filled with sweet red bean paste, making them a delightful treat for any time of day. These comforting buns combine a tender milk-flavored dough with a classic sweet filling, perfect for breakfast or a cozy snack.

Ingredients
- 18 ounces sweetened red bean paste
- 1 tablespoon sesame seeds
- 3 cups bread flour
- 1/4 cup sugar
- 1/2 teaspoon salt
- 1 teaspoon instant yeast
- 1 tablespoon milk powder (optional)
- 1 cup whole milk (warm)
- 1/3 cup heavy cream (warm)
- 1 egg
- 1 egg yolk
- 1 tablespoon whole milk
Instructions
- Step 1: In a stand mixer fitted with a dough hook, combine bread flour, sugar, salt, instant yeast, and milk powder. Add warm whole milk, warm heavy cream, and the egg. Knead on low speed for 10 minutes until the dough is tacky but elastic. Do not add extra flour. Cover and let it rest in a warm place for 2 hours or until it doubles in size.
- Step 2: Lightly flour a work surface and divide the dough into 9 equal pieces. Shape each piece into a ball by folding the sides underneath and pinching to seal. Cover loosely with plastic wrap to keep moist.
- Step 3: Gently stretch each dough ball into a 4-inch circle, keeping the center thicker. Place about 1/4 cup of sweetened red bean paste in the center. Bring the edges of the dough up and pinch them together to seal the filling inside. Roll the sealed bun between your hands to smooth the surface. Place each bun seam-side down on a parchment-lined baking sheet. Repeat with all pieces.
- Step 4 (Optional): Dust your hands with a little flour and gently press down on each bun to flatten slightly. Use scissors to make 5 slits around the edge of the dough to create a flower shape.
- Step 5: Let the buns rise in a warm area for 30 minutes to 1 hour, until nearly doubled in size. Meanwhile, preheat your oven to 350°F (175°C).
- Step 6: In a small bowl, whisk together the egg yolk and whole milk. Brush the mixture evenly over the tops of the buns and sprinkle with sesame seeds. Bake for 20 minutes until golden and cooked through. Serve warm for the best texture and flavor.
Tips & Variations
- Use warm liquids (milk and cream) to help activate the yeast and develop a soft dough.
- If you prefer a less sweet bun, reduce the sugar slightly in the dough or choose a less sweet red bean paste.
- For allergy-friendly options, substitute milk with plant-based alternatives and use egg replacers for the wash.
- Sprinkle some toasted sesame seeds inside the filling for extra texture and nuttiness.
Storage
Store the buns in an airtight container at room temperature for up to 2 days. To keep longer, refrigerate for up to 5 days or freeze for up to 1 month. Reheat gently in a steamer or microwave before serving to restore softness.
How to Serve

Serve this delicious recipe with your favorite sides.
FAQs
Can I make the dough by hand without a stand mixer?
Yes, you can knead the dough by hand on a floured surface for about 15 minutes until it becomes smooth and elastic. The process may take more time but will yield the same results.
What can I use instead of sweetened red bean paste?
You can substitute with other sweet fillings like smooth sweetened black sesame paste, custard, or even chocolate spread for a different twist on these milk buns.
PrintRed Bean Milk Buns Recipe
Delight in these fluffy and slightly sweet Red Bean Milk Buns, filled with smooth sweetened red bean paste and topped with a glossy egg wash and toasted sesame seeds. These soft buns are made with a tender milk-based dough, perfect for an afternoon snack or light dessert, combining the subtle flavors of creamy milk and sweet red bean in a delightful bread treat.
- Prep Time: 20 minutes
- Cook Time: 20 minutes
- Total Time: 3 hours 40 minutes
- Yield: 9 buns 1x
- Category: Bread
- Method: Baking
- Cuisine: Chinese
Ingredients
Dough Ingredients
- 3 cups bread flour
- 1/4 cup sugar
- 1/2 teaspoon salt
- 1 teaspoon instant yeast
- 1 tablespoon milk powder (optional)
- 1 cup whole milk, warm
- 1/3 cup heavy cream, warm
- 1 egg
Filling
- 18 ounces sweetened red bean paste
Topping
- 1 egg yolk
- 1 tablespoon whole milk
- 1 tablespoon sesame seeds
Instructions
- Make the dough: In a stand mixer fitted with a dough hook, combine bread flour, sugar, salt, instant yeast, and milk powder. Add warm whole milk, warm heavy cream, and 1 egg. Knead on low speed for 10 minutes until the dough is slightly tacky but smooth—avoid adding extra flour. Cover the dough and let it rise for 2 hours or until doubled in size.
- Portion the dough: Lightly flour your work surface. Divide the dough into 9 equal portions. Shape each into a tight ball by tucking and pinching the dough edges underneath. Cover with plastic wrap to prevent drying.
- Form the red bean buns: Using your hands, gently stretch each dough ball into a 4-inch circle, keeping the center thicker for the filling. Place about 1/4 cup of sweetened red bean paste in the middle. Carefully gather the edges up and pinch to seal the filling inside. Roll between your hands to smooth the seam and form a neat ball. Arrange the buns seam-side down on a parchment-lined baking sheet. Repeat with remaining dough and filling.
- Optional flower shape: Dust your hands lightly with flour and gently press each bun to slightly flatten. Use scissors to cut five small slits around the top edge to create a flower petal effect.
- Second rise: Let the buns rest and rise for 30 minutes to 1 hour in a warm spot until nearly doubled in size. Meanwhile, preheat the oven to 350°F (175°C).
- Egg wash and bake: Mix egg yolk with 1 tablespoon whole milk and brush the mixture generously over the buns. Sprinkle sesame seeds on top for a nutty finish. Bake the buns in the preheated oven for 20 minutes, until golden and cooked through. Serve warm for best flavor and texture.
Notes
- Ensure milk and cream are warm but not hot to activate yeast without killing it.
- Do not over-flour the dough as it should remain soft and slightly tacky for optimal texture.
- The red bean paste should be sweetened and smooth—homemade or store-bought works.
- For a vegan version, consider substituting milk, cream, and eggs with plant-based alternatives.
- If dough is sticky, chill briefly before portioning to make shaping easier.
- Store leftover buns in an airtight container at room temperature for up to 2 days or freeze for longer storage.
Keywords: red bean buns, milk buns, sweet red bean paste, Asian bread, steamed bun alternative, soft bread rolls, homemade buns

